#5My 15 year old car is starting to get some issues so I was browsing some EVs. They are literally twice as expensive as a comparable ICE car, even after tax incentives. With interest rates where they are, 22k vs 44k is a huge difference. They are just unaffordable for a lot of people.
(Also, was looking for a sedan. They don’t seem to make a lot of EV sedans, and I find the hatchback type ones kinda ugly. That’s just me though)
